<br /> <br />At the September 10 work session, staff is requesting additional guidance about the City Council’s <br />preferred options. Four options are outlined in this summary. A public hearing on this topic is <br />tentatively scheduled for September 17. <br /> <br /> <br />RELATED CITY POLICIES <br />This topic relates to the Safe Community Vision: A community where people feel safe, valued and <br />welcome, and increased downtown development, as well as support for small and local businesses. <br /> <br /> <br />COUNCIL OPTIONS <br /> <br />There are several options the council may pursue. Outlined below are four options: <br /> <br /> <br />1.Extend the existing Downtown Public Safety Zone until __________. <br /> <br />2.Eliminate the 90-day exclusion. This would leave the one-year exclusion, which is instituted <br />upon conviction of the underlying charge. <br /> <br />3.Allow the Downtown Public Safety Zone to sunset effective November 30, 2012. <br /> <br />4.Provide court-appointed attorneys for all people receiving a downtown public safety zone notice <br />to appear. <br /> <br /> <br />CITY MANAGER’S RECOMMENDATION <br /> <br />The City Manager recommends the following changes to the current legislation: <br /> <br />a.Extend the program for two years by extending the sunset date from November 30, 2012, to <br />November 30, 2014. <br /> <br />b.Retain the 90-day exclusion process <br /> <br />c.Provide court-appointed attorneys for eligible defendants <br /> <br /> <br />SUGGESTED MOTION <br /> <br />No motion is proposed for the work session. <br /> <br /> <br />ATTACHMENTS <br /> <br /> <br />A.Guidelines for Use of Downtown Public Safety Zone <br /> <br /> <br />FOR MORE INFORMATION <br /> <br />Staff Contact: Lieutenant Sam Kamkar <br />Telephone: 541-682-5436 <br />Staff E-Mail: sam.s.kamkar@ci.eugene.or.us <br />S:\CMO\2012 Council Agendas\M120910\S120910B.doc <br />
